Altai breeders gave summer residents an unpretentious tomato. Description of the variety:
- designed for open ground and temporary (film) shelters;
- average ripening period (from germination to harvest sampling - 100 days);
- indeterminate plant (height reaches 1 m 80 cm);
- 6 clusters are formed on the main stem;
- leaves are dark green.
Compliance with the rules of agricultural technology allows you to get 6.4 kg/sq. m of delicious fruits. The plant requires staking and shaping. The Burning Heart is included in the State Register of the Russian Federation. Recommended for growing in private plots and personal gardens.

Tomatoes grown outside are tastier and more aromatic than greenhouse tomatoes. Gardeners are pleased with the following characteristics of the Flaming Heart:
- pink-raspberry color;
- heart shape;
- weight up to 240 g;
- juicy, fleshy pulp;
- thick skin;
- sweet, dessert taste;
- weak ribbing of the fruit.
It is possible to collect 2-3 kg of fleshy berries from a bush. Gardeners note the transportability of the Flaming Heart. Tomatoes remain marketable during transportation.
The berries of the first harvest weigh 220-240 g. Then they become noticeably smaller. Gardeners have found the use of non-standard products: they roll whole products into jars, make pastes and juices. The fiery assortment is tasty and healthy: tomatoes contain lycopene, ascorbic acid, and sugars.
How to get a good harvest
Growing indeterminate tomatoes has its own peculiarities. Reviews from experienced gardeners will help you recognize them. Proper application of the advice of agronomists will provide seven tomatoes for the whole summer. The following should be remembered:
- seeds from reputable producers are ready for sowing: no stimulation required;
- your own material should be checked for germination and disinfected;
- seedlings need to be taken care of 50-60 days before the intended planting in a permanent place;
- plants dive when they grow 2 true leaves;
- seedlings are illuminated, hardened, fed;
- the beds are prepared in advance (mature compost is laid in the fall, a mineral complex is laid in the spring);
- the use of calcium nitrate will strengthen plants and increase productivity;
- tomatoes should be shaded 3-4 days after planting on the ridges;
- plants need moderate watering;
- Ripe fruits should be collected regularly (the bush will give strength to those that ripen).
The flaming heart requires the formation of 2 stems. It is recommended to lighten the plant until the brush becomes full. A garter to the support is required.
What did the gardeners decide?
Reviews from gardeners are favorable. Burning Heart is a productive variety. The fruits are beautiful and tasty. Purpose: from salad to canning. Berries do not lose marketability during transportation.
Gardeners are disappointed by the low shelf life (a week in the refrigerator). Large bushes are difficult to cover with film during cold weather. But the advantages outweigh the disadvantages. The flaming heart has earned the love of gardeners.
